Output 5c86b6a3be56b77faaa52a96c3ada9f1cf63dc3e284291854a24c54a23a84d44:1

value
18236000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3c404fc8b7533377bf85cf6172322a19b983fe OP_EQUAL
address
MAZk1Kavnsbu3okmRbXF6PWeHrYZCYMHaU
transaction
5c86b6a3be56b77faaa52a96c3ada9f1cf63dc3e284291854a24c54a23a84d44
spent
true